BAP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

275 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Credicorp (BAP)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$12B — down 0.78% from $12.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new BAP positions and 22 closed out — a net gain of 9 holders — while 119 added to existing stakes and 93 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Baillie Gifford & Co, adding an estimated $126M. The largest seller was Parametric Portfolio Associates, cutting an estimated $82.2M.
